Transaction 66b2bce4b63de4586a88d9c618326414a9c676d152a327c9af11a22023438806
1 Input
1 Output
-
66b2bce4b63de4586a88d9c618326414a9c676d152a327c9af11a22023438806:0
- value
- 10000118
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4e761ef84c35411f5fb8ca649b2639152512e38e83188087d8c222e6018384ff
- address
- bc1pfempa7zvx4q37hacefjfkf3ez5j39cuwsvvgpp7ccg3wvqvrsnlsqae3j9